This form is a surface use agreement.

Ohio Surface Use Agreement is a legally binding contract that defines the terms and conditions regarding the use of surface land for various activities, specifically related to the extraction and exploration of minerals, oil, and gas resources in the state of Ohio. It outlines the rights and responsibilities of landowners and operators, aiming to establish a mutually beneficial relationship and protect the interests of both parties involved. This agreement is crucial in ensuring that surface landowners are fairly compensated for any disturbances caused by the extraction operations, while also safeguarding the rights of operators to access and utilize the resources beneath the surface. It serves as a key tool in facilitating effective communication, proper planning, and mitigation of potential conflicts between resource developers and landowners. Different types of Ohio Surface Use Agreements exist to cater to the diverse needs and characteristics of various extraction projects. Some common types include: 1. Oil and Gas Surface Use Agreement: This agreement specifically focuses on the exploration and extraction of oil and gas reserves from the land. It includes provisions related to equipment placement, access roads, pipelines, and other necessary infrastructure. 2. Mineral Surface Use Agreement: These agreements are specifically designed for extracting various minerals, such as coal, limestone, clay, or sand. Landowners grant permission to operators to extract minerals from their properties and establish guidelines for reclamation and restoration of the land once mining activities cease. 3. Shale Gas Surface Use Agreement: Shale gas extraction, particularly from formations like the Marcellus and Utica, has gained significant attention in Ohio. Surface use agreements specific to shale gas operations outline the terms and conditions for drilling, hydraulic fracturing, water usage, and potential environmental impacts. 4. Wind Energy Surface Use Agreement: While not directly related to mineral extraction, wind energy agreements also fall under surface use agreements. These agreements allow wind energy companies to lease and access land for the installation of wind turbines and associated infrastructure. Each type of Ohio Surface Use Agreement may have varying provisions, depending on the particular project, location, and resource being extracted. These agreements address critical aspects like compensation, access rights, environmental safeguards, restoration obligations, liability, and protocols for dispute resolution. It is important for landowners and operators to thoroughly negotiate and understand the terms of the agreement to ensure a fair and transparent relationship between the parties involved.

These basic lease terms ? bonus, royalty, term, delay rental (if any) and shut-in royalty --are typically the "deal terms" negotiated between the Lessor and Lessee. The Lessor typically wants the highest bonus, delay rental and royalty fraction he can get, and the shortest primary term. The Lessee wants the opposite.

A surface use agreement, which is also sometimes referred to as a land use agreement, is an agreement between the landowner and an oil and gas company or an operator for the use of the landowner's land in the development of the oil and gas.

The primary term on average is 3 years. Companies can add a 2-year extension if they wish. The company that executed the lease uses this time period to achieve drilling the well. Once that is completed, the secondary term begins and lasts for as long as the well is producing.

A mineral lease is a contractual agreement between the owner of a mineral estate (known as the lessor), and another party such as an oil and gas company (the lessee). The lease gives an oil or gas company the right to explore for and develop the oil and gas deposits in the area described in the lease.

An oil or gas lease is a legal document where a landowner grants an individual or company the right to extract oil or gas from beneath the landowner's property. Courts generally find leases to be legally binding, so it is very important that you understand all the terms of a lease before you sign it.

To find the ownership of mineral rights in Ohio is not a difficult activity. It's quite easy as ownership of mineral rights are recorded in any of the 88 county recorder offices in Ohio.
